麻豆小视频在线观看_中文黄色一级片_久久久成人精品_成片免费观看视频大全_午夜精品久久久久久久99热浪潮_成人一区二区三区四区

首頁 > 開發 > Java > 正文

Spring Boot 從靜態json文件中讀取數據所需字段

2024-07-14 08:40:59
字體:
來源:轉載
供稿:網友

•在實體中,通常使用類似字典表的文件來表示屬性,文件大都配置在配置文件中,也可以是靜態文件,本次記錄如何從靜態json文件中讀取所需字段。

1.文件格式以及路徑

spring,boot,靜態文件,讀,取數據,讀取數據

2.加載文件

import org.springframework.beans.factory.annotation.Value;import org.springframework.core.io.Resource;@Value("classpath:static/data/area.json")private Resource areaRes;

3.讀取文件

注意:文件讀取時因為存在中文,需要設置編碼格式

@Override  public void test(){  for (int i = 1; i < 8; i ++) {   try {     String areaData = IOUtils.toString(areaRes.getInputStream(), Charset.forName("UTF-8"));     List<String> districtNames = JsonPath.read(areaData, "$.districts[?(@.id == " + i + ")].name");     String district = districtNames.get(0);     System.out.println("數字"+ i+ "表示的行政區為:" + district);   }catch (IOException e){     e.printStackTrace();   }  }  }

輸出結果

數字1表示的行政區為:瑤海區
數字2表示的行政區為:廬陽區
數字3表示的行政區為:蜀山區
數字4表示的行政區為:包河區
數字5表示的行政區為:經濟技術開發區
數字6表示的行政區為:高新技術產業開發區
數字7表示的行政區為:新站高新技術產業開發區

總結

以上所述是小編給大家介紹的Spring Boot 從靜態json文件中讀取數據所需字段,希望對大家有所幫助,如果大家有任何疑問請給我留言,小編會及時回復大家的。在此也非常感謝大家對VeVb武林網網站的支持!


注:相關教程知識閱讀請移步到JAVA教程頻道。
發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: aa国产视频一区二区 | caoporn国产一区二区 | 欧美日韩免费一区 | 国产好片无限资源 | 久久久久久久久久久久免费 | 亚洲成人免费视频在线 | 国产精品18久久久久久久久 | 日韩视频一区二区三区四区 | av不卡免费在线 | 黄色免费小网站 | 免费黄色欧美视频 | 国产精品久久久久久久久久10秀 | 国产99一区二区 | 欧美日本中文字幕 | 91精品中文字幕 | 青青操国产 | 亚洲视频精品在线 | 国产精品久久久久久久久久久久久久久 | 欧美成人高清视频 | 成熟女人特级毛片www免费 | 成人在线视频国产 | 欧美 亚洲 激情 | 精品国产一区二区三区四 | 龙床上的呻吟高h | 久久综合给合久久狠狠狠97色69 | 精品国产一区二区三区天美传媒 | 欧美综合在线观看 | 国产一级毛片a | www.mitao| 久久久久久久不卡 | 99精品视频在线观看免费播放 | 国产美女爽到喷白浆的 | 看免费黄色大片 | 久久久久在线观看 | 免费在线成人网 | 色婷婷一区二区三区 | 欧美aⅴ在线观看 | 久久不射电影网 | 噜噜在线视频 | 国产精品91在线 | 7777欧美|